Interview with Kevin Whiteley: Founder and Editor in Chief of “Criminal Class Press.”

I wanted to share the transcript of this interview with all my readers out in the blogosphere.  My friend Kevin started the literary journal Criminal Class Press a number years ago as a home for literature that is “on the edge” and exposes the dark side in us all.  It has really taken off and I’m proud to have him as a friend.

Kevin is touring the west coast with a number of writers who have contributed to the journal in the past, including Windy City Story Slam founder Bill Hillman.  If you’re in California, they’ll be at Book Soup in Hollywood and Edinburgh Castle Pub in San Francisco this coming week.
